How you create impact
As the National Road Logistics Operations Manager, you will play a pivotal leadership role within our Road Logistics team. Your primary focus is to ensure operational excellence, customer satisfaction, and sustained profitability across domestic and cross-border transportation. You will lead strategic initiatives, manage resources efficiently, and ensure that our operational standards consistently meet or exceed expectations.
What we would like you to bring
Lead and manage day-to-day Road Logistics operations nationally, ensuring high performance and adherence to KPIs.
Oversee the structured rollout of our Centre of Excellence for Domestic and Cross-Border Transport (where applicable), including haulage activities.
Drive continuous improvement initiatives, adopting best practices to optimize efficiency and reduce operational costs.
Develop and implement robust vendor management strategies to ensure service quality and cost control.
Align and optimize internal resource allocation across business activities for maximum service delivery.
Oversee the development and implementation of operational and reporting systems, including Transport Management Systems (TMS) and other digital tools.
Integrate automation and digital transformation initiatives to enhance operational agility.
Review and refine operational policies, standards, and procedures in line with company goals and compliance requirements.
Ensure effective incident and crisis management protocols, including robust business continuity plans.
Monitor the department’s annual budget and implement corrective actions for any variances.
Drive initiatives that lead to revenue growth and improved profit margins.
Actively support business development by showcasing operational capabilities during client engagements.
Collaborate with sales and key account teams to develop and validate SOPs for new contracts.
Ensure smooth onboarding of new customers and maintain high levels of service delivery.
Inspire and guide your team toward operational excellence, ensuring clarity of roles, ownership, and accountability.
Build and maintain strong relationships with key stakeholders, both internal and external.
Champion a high-performance culture that prioritizes collaboration, customer satisfaction, and continuous improvement.
